What companies run services between Warsop, England and Luton, England?

You can take a bus from Church Street to Luton via Mansfield Bus Station, Mansfield, Nottingham, and Kettering in around 3h 52m. Alternatively, National Express operates a bus from Broad Marsh Bus Station to Luton Station Interchange hourly. Tickets cost £30–55 and the journey takes 2h 50m.
